The Timeless Appeal of Blackjack

Blackjack, also known as 21, is arguably the most popular table game in casinos globally. Its enduring appeal lies in its simple yet strategic gameplay. The core objective is to beat the dealer by having a hand value closer to 21 than the dealer’s, without exceeding it. What sets blackjack apart is the element of player skill – decisions made during gameplay significantly impact the outcome, unlike purely luck-based games. This strategic element has attracted mathematicians and savvy players who have developed various strategies to improve their odds.

Basic strategy charts, widely available online, provide players with the optimal move for every possible hand combination. While these charts don’t guarantee a win, they drastically reduce the house edge, making blackjack one of the most favorable games for players. Beyond basic strategy, more advanced techniques, such as card counting, aim to exploit subtle advantages, although casino operators often discourage or prohibit such practices.

Understanding Blackjack Variations

While the core principles of blackjack remain consistent, various rule variations can significantly influence the game’s house edge. These variations include the number of decks used, whether the dealer hits or stands on soft 17, and the availability of options like doubling down and splitting pairs. European blackjack, for example, often has different rules than American blackjack, impacting optimal strategy.

Understanding these nuances is crucial for maximizing your chances of winning. Before sitting down at a blackjack table, it’s important to familiarize yourself with the specific rules in place at that casino. This knowledge allows you to adjust your strategy accordingly and make informed decisions. Failing to consider these subtleties can lead to unnecessary losses.

Roulette: A Game of Pure Chance

Roulette, with its spinning wheel and cascading ball, is a symbol of casino glamour. Its origins trace back to 17th-century France, and it has captivated players with its simplicity and suspense. The game involves betting on where the ball will land on a numbered wheel, with various betting options offering different payouts and levels of risk. Unlike blackjack, roulette is primarily a game of chance; however, understanding the different bets and their associated probabilities can enhance your enjoyment and potentially maximize your returns.

There are two main variations of roulette: European and American. European roulette features a wheel with 37 numbers (1-36 and a single zero), while American roulette adds a double zero, increasing the house edge. This seemingly small difference significantly impacts the odds, making European roulette generally more favorable for players. Roulette Betting Strategies

Numerous roulette betting strategies have been developed over the years, each claiming to increase your chances of winning. Some popular strategies include the Martingale system, where you double your bet after each loss, and the Fibonacci sequence, where you increment your bet based on the Fibonacci numbers. However, it’s crucial to understand these systems don’t guarantee a win; they simply alter your betting pattern.

In fact, due to the inherent house edge, sustained use of these strategies can quickly deplete your bankroll. While they can provide short-term gains, they are not foolproof and should be approached with caution. Understanding Roulette Payouts

Bet Type
Payout
Probability
Straight Up (Single Number) 35:1 2.70% (European) / 2.63% (American)
Split Bet (Two Numbers) 17:1 5.41% (European) / 5.26% (American)
Corner Bet (Four Numbers) 8:1 10.81% (European) / 10.53% (American)
Red/Black 1:1 48.65% (European) / 47.37% (American)

The Enduring Legacy of Baccarat

Baccarat is often associated with high rollers and James Bond films, but beneath the air of sophistication lies a surprisingly simple game. The objective is to bet on which of two hands, the Player or the Banker, will have a value closest to 9. The game’s elegance and relatively low house edge have made it a favorite among discerning players, particularly in Asia.

Unlike blackjack, where player skill can influence the outcome, baccarat is largely a game of chance. Players have limited control over the game, as the cards are dealt according to a strict set of rules. However, the strategic element lies in choosing which hand to bet on, considering the slight advantage the Banker hand enjoys. Understanding the rules of drawing additional cards is also important, although the dealer manages this automatically.

Baccarat’s Different Variations

There are three main variations of baccarat: Chemin de Fer, Banque, and Punto Banco. Punto Banco, also known as American baccarat, is the most common version found in casinos worldwide. In this version, the casino acts as the Banker, and players bet against the Bank. Chemin de Fer and Banque are more complex games typically played in European casinos, often involving players taking turns being the Banker.

Each variation has its unique nuances and rules, but the core objective – betting on the hand closest to 9 – remains the same. Punto Banco is preferred by many due to its simplicity and accessibility. It is a fast paced game.

  • Punto Banco: The most common version, with the casino as the Banker.
  • Chemin de Fer: Players take turns being the Banker.
  • Banque: Similar to Chemin de Fer, offering a slightly different structure.

Understanding Baccarat Bets

Bet Type
Payout
House Edge
Banker 1:1 (5% Commission) 1.06%
Player 1:1 1.24%
Tie 8:1 14.36%
